Purpose and goals

Through collaboration, create conditions for enough water of the right quality for the city’s various needs with a minimum of environmental and climate impact.

Expected effects and results

The project entails a significant step towards sustainable water for all by 2050 by:

  • Addressing technology, governance, and behavioral change that leads to reduced water withdrawal.

  • Developing and implementing solutions to reduce both water losses and overuse.

  • Making consumption visible and creating incentives for measures strengthens the project’s water efficiency.

  • Identifying and addressing obstacles that currently limit reuse. The project increases knowledge and understanding of needs-adapted water quality, which enables wider use of recycled water.

  • Simplifying the diversification of water sources and qualities, reduced leakage, and improved control of the water and sewage utility, for a more robust supply system. Local solutions relieve the central network in critical situations, e.g., in case of water shortage or risk of waterborne infection, and create security even during disruptions.

Planned structure and implementation

The transition lab will be established step-by-step with Gothenburg as a test bed and can thereafter be expanded into a national hub for innovation and consultation.
